对象存储swift可以用于一些什么场景,深入探讨对象存储在Swift开发中的应用场景与优势
- 综合资讯
- 2024-10-29 23:50:30
- 2

对象存储Swift广泛应用于多媒体内容管理、大数据分析、云服务等场景。其优势在于高效处理海量数据,支持高并发访问,便于与现有系统集成。深入探讨其在Swift开发中的应用...
对象存储Swift广泛应用于多媒体内容管理、大数据分析、云服务等场景。其优势在于高效处理海量数据,支持高并发访问,便于与现有系统集成。深入探讨其在Swift开发中的应用,可优化用户体验,提升开发效率。
随着移动互联网的快速发展,数据存储需求日益增长,对象存储作为一种新兴的存储方式,凭借其高扩展性、高可用性和低成本等特点,逐渐成为众多企业青睐的数据存储解决方案,Swift作为一种优秀的编程语言,在iOS、macOS等领域拥有广泛的用户基础,本文将深入探讨对象存储在Swift开发中的应用场景与优势,帮助开发者更好地利用对象存储技术。
对象存储在Swift开发中的应用场景
1、云端数据存储
在Swift开发中,对象存储可以用于实现云端数据存储,通过将数据存储在对象存储平台,开发者可以方便地实现数据的持久化、备份和恢复,对象存储平台通常具备高可用性和高扩展性,能够满足大规模数据存储的需求。
2、图片、视频等媒体文件存储
Swift开发中,图片、视频等媒体文件存储是常见的场景,对象存储可以提供大规模、低成本、易扩展的存储空间,满足媒体文件存储需求,开发者可以利用对象存储平台提供的API,实现媒体文件的上传、下载、删除等操作。
3、文件共享与协作
在Swift开发中,文件共享与协作是重要的应用场景,对象存储可以提供便捷的文件共享功能,用户可以将文件上传至对象存储平台,与他人共享和协作,对象存储平台通常支持多种访问控制策略,确保文件的安全性。
4、移动应用数据同步
Swift开发中,移动应用数据同步是常见的场景,对象存储可以提供数据同步服务,实现用户在不同设备间同步数据,开发者可以利用对象存储平台提供的SDK,方便地实现数据同步功能。
5、大数据分析
Swift开发中,大数据分析是重要的应用场景,对象存储可以存储海量数据,为大数据分析提供数据基础,开发者可以利用对象存储平台提供的API,实现数据的查询、分析和处理。
6、互联网+行业应用
在互联网+行业应用中,对象存储可以提供强大的数据存储支持,在智慧城市、智慧医疗、智慧教育等领域,对象存储可以存储大量的行业数据,为行业应用提供数据支持。
对象存储在Swift开发中的优势
1、高扩展性
对象存储平台通常采用分布式存储架构,具备高扩展性,开发者可以根据需求,轻松地增加存储空间,满足业务增长需求。
2、高可用性
对象存储平台采用多节点存储、数据冗余等策略,确保数据的高可用性,即使在部分节点故障的情况下,系统仍然可以正常运行。
3、低成本
相比传统的存储方案,对象存储具有较低的成本,开发者可以按需购买存储资源,降低企业运营成本。
4、易用性
对象存储平台提供丰富的API和SDK,方便开发者进行集成和使用,开发者可以轻松实现数据的上传、下载、删除等操作。
5、安全性
对象存储平台采用多种安全策略,如访问控制、数据加密等,确保数据的安全性。
6、灵活性
对象存储支持多种数据存储格式,如图片、视频、文本等,满足不同业务场景的需求。
对象存储在Swift开发中具有广泛的应用场景和优势,通过深入挖掘对象存储技术在Swift开发中的应用,开发者可以更好地实现云端数据存储、媒体文件存储、文件共享与协作、移动应用数据同步、大数据分析以及互联网+行业应用等功能,随着对象存储技术的不断发展,其在Swift开发中的应用前景将更加广阔。
本文链接:https://www.zhitaoyun.cn/426181.html
发表评论